Microsoft Teams has not removed Planner. You can still access Planner by selecting the Tasks by Planner and To Do tab within Teams. This integration allows you to manage and track your tasks efficiently. If you are having trouble finding it, ensure that your Teams app is up-to-date and that your organization has enabled this feature.
